About This Vintage 1950 Edition

"The Common Life in the Body of Christ" by L. S. Thornton is a theological exploration published by Dacre Press in London. This third edition, released in 1950, follows its initial publication in 1942. Thornton, a respected theologian with degrees from Cambridge and Durham, delves into the communal aspects of Christian life. This edition is distinct for its comprehensive update to the original text, reflecting the evolving discourse in mid-20th century theology.
